Transaction 179cf8cc27863a32f7f417294b55cef5db3016eec727521e462b877b7639d91e
1 Input
2 Outputs
- 179cf8cc27863a32f7f417294b55cef5db3016eec727521e462b877b7639d91e:0
- 179cf8cc27863a32f7f417294b55cef5db3016eec727521e462b877b7639d91e:1
value 100000
address mkxyMi8G48aL9iN8MPWpxuVf3UCeDHWhyb
value 171530000
address mpRZxxp5FtmQipEWJPa1NY9FmPsva3exUd